Milton Middleswart Obituary

Milton "Chub" A. Middleswart, 86, of Gillet, Wyoming, passed away on April 4, 2024, in Fruitland, Idaho.

Milt loved the great outdoors, hunting, fishing, traveling, and being with family and friends. He graduated from Arvada High School in Arvada, Wyoming, and the University of Wyoming in Laramie, Wyoming. He spent the next four years helping his mom work on a ranch in Biddle, Montana, before moving to Virginia City, Nevada, to work for the National Cash Register Company in Reno, Nevada. After 20 years of service, he retired and became a partner at Taylor Canyon Resort in Tuscarora, Nevada. He later sold his shares and moved to Ontario, Oregon, to help his aunt Fernell Read. He then moved to a retirement home in Fruitland, Idaho, where he lived until his passing.

He is survived by his sister, Eva Dabney; five nieces; one nephew, Aunt Fernell Read; stepdaughters Sylvia Dickenson and Beverly Tyler; granddaughter Nicole Thatcher; and great-grandsons Will, Nolan, and Eli. Chub was preceded in death by his parents, grandparents, brother-in-law Fred Dabney, stepson Tom Tyler, and one nephew.

A service in memory of Milt will be held at Haren-Wood Funeral Chapel in Ontario on Saturday, April 20 at 2:00 PM. In lieu of flowers, donations can be made to Shriners Children's Hospital at https://www.shrinerschildrens.org/en/giving.
